Holy cow I found a string!!!!! It was wrapped around her bottom bill and slowly tightening every time she swallowed! No wonder she wouldn't eat! Thats what was causing the swelling ! I wrapped her in a burrito and was giving her electrolytes and water when I saw something come out of her mouth down by the swelling. I cut it in half then removed what I could see, I did not yank it out as I have no idea how far diwn it went. She immediately started talking and drank and had some food soup.
Hopefully there is no other blockage or problems and we can heal.
What should I be looking for now? Signs of infection? No poop? Lame, no eating etc?? Can I put polysporin or some ointment on her bill where the string was cutting in?
I will keep checking her mouth for more string?! I wonder if her tongue is swollen too?? I couldn't tell if it was under or over tongue, it happened very quickly once I saw it.
